Summary: The carefully crafted fifth edition of ManufacturingTechnology offers essential understanding of conventional and emergingtechnologies in the field of foundry, forming and welding. With latestindustrial case studies and expanded topical coverage, the textbook offers adeep knowledge of the ever-evolving subject. A dedicated section onchapter-wise GATE questions provide support to the competitive examinations’aspirants. This revised edition also maintains its principle of lucidpresentation and easy to understand pedagogy. This makes the book a completepackage on the subject which will greatly benefit students, teachers andpracticing engineers. KEY FEAUTERS: 1. Two new chapters, on Ceramics and Glass; CompositeMaterials 2. Coverage on new topics, like Shot Peening,Non-destructive Testing of Welds, Thixocasting, Metal Injection Moulding, RapidPrototyping for Pattern Making etc 3. Latest industrial case studies, like Ductile IronCasting, Gating System Design for Investment Casting, etc. 4. A separate section on chapter-wise GATE previous yearsquestions 5. Extensive Pedagogy a. Easy to understand illustrations: 463 b. Solved Examples: 36 c. Review Questions: 518 d. Unsolved Problems: 47 e. Multiple Choice Questions: 188 6. Web Supplement a. For Instructors: Solution Manual and PowerPoint LectureSlides b. For Students: Multiple Choice Questions and Chapter-wise GATEPrevious Years’ Questions
